| Description: | MISSING AS OF 6/17/2003 "Hull. A Gigantic Enterprise. Mr Herbert Morrison - Minister of Transport - sets great building scheme to cost 2 million pounds into being." Hull, East Yorkshire. Herbert Morrison (looking very young) speaks about building project. A group of men stand behind him. He is talking about the building of a large bridge over the River Humber. Shots of podium - an unidentified man is speaking about the history of the project. Morrison is asked to lay a stone marking his visit - he makes a short speech and jokingly refers to Winston Churchill and his bricklaying exploits. | |
